首页AI技术人工智能技术主要算法-人工智能技术算法有哪些

人工智能技术主要算法-人工智能技术算法有哪些

C0f3d30c8C0f3d30c8时间2024-03-30 01:06:20分类AI技术浏览38
导读:大家好,今天小编关注到一个比较有意思的话题,就是关于人工智能技术主要算法的问题,于是小编就整理了6个相关介绍人工智能技术主要算法的解答,让我们一起看看吧。人工智能三大算法?人工智能算法有哪些?人工智能常用的算法有遗传算法决策树神经网络的对吗?人工智能多半是指一种算法对吗?人工智能下围棋主要应用了哪种算法技术?什……...

大家好,今天小编关注到一个比较有意思的话题,就是关于人工智能技术主要算法问题,于是小编就整理了6个相关介绍人工智能技术主要算法的解答,让我们一起看看吧。

  1. 人工智能三大算法?
  2. 人工智能算法有哪些?
  3. 人工智能常用的算法有遗传算法决策树神经网络的对吗?
  4. 人工智能多半是指一种算法对吗?
  5. 人工智能下围棋主要应用了哪种算法技术?
  6. 什么是人工智能算法?

人工智能三大算法?

1. 决策

根据一些 feature 进行分类,每个节点提一个问题,通过判断,将数据分为两类,再继续提问。这些问题是根据已有数据学习出来的,再投入新数据的时候,就可以根据这棵树上的问题,将数据划分到合适的叶子上。

人工智能技术主要算法-人工智能技术算法有哪些
图片来源网络,侵删)

2. 随机森林

在源数据中随机选取数据,组成几个子集;

S 矩阵是源数据,有 1-N 条数据,A B C 是feature,最后一列C是类别;

人工智能技术主要算法-人工智能技术算法有哪些
(图片来源网络,侵删)

由 S 随机生成 M 个子矩阵。

3. 马尔可夫

Markov Chains 由 state 和 transitions 组成;

人工智能技术主要算法-人工智能技术算法有哪些
(图片来源网络,侵删)

例如,根据这一句话 ‘the quick brown fox jumps over the lazy dog’,要得到 markov chain;

步骤,先给每一个单词设定成一个状态,然后计算状态间转换的概率

人工智能算法有哪些

人工智能算法有:

1.线性回归;

2.逻辑回归;

3.线性判别分析

4.决策树;

5.学习矢量量化

6.支持向量机;

7.最近邻算法;

8.随机森林算法;

9.人工神经网络

人工智能算法包括机器人工智能算法包括机器学习,它的目的是通过算法学习已有数据来预测未来趋势;强化学习,它利用反馈信息来学习;规则学习,它使用特定规则来识别输入数据;深度学习,它使用神经网络与多层结构来解决问题。

人工智能领域算法主要有线性回归、逻辑回归、逻辑回归、决策树、朴素贝叶斯、K-均值、随机森林、降准和人工神经网络(ANN)等。

线性回归是最流行的的机器学习算法。线性回归就是找到一条直线,并通过这条直线尽可能拟合散点图中的数据点。主要是通过方程和该数据变量拟合来表示自变量和数值结果来预测未来值。

人工智能常用的算法有遗传算法决策树神经网络的对吗?

不完全正确。
1. 人工智能常用的算法包括遗传算法、决策树和神经网络,但并不仅限于这三个算法。
还有其他常见的算法如支持向量机、K近邻算法等都被广泛用于人工智能领域。
2. 遗传算法是通过模拟自然选择和遗传机制来优化问题的解,决策树是一种基于树状结构的分类模型,神经网络是一种模拟人脑神经元网络的算法。
它们在不同的问题和场景下有各自的优缺点和适用性。
3.因此,虽然遗传算法、决策树和神经网络是人工智能中常用的算法,但并不能代表全部常用算法。

人工智能多半是指一种算法对吗?

人工智能多半是指一种算法我认为是对的。人工智能是基于互联网高速发展的前提下提出和延伸出来的一种新的概念方向。并且是相对于传统的,低级的,简单的计算机算法来说,是一种更高级,更自动化程序化算法,并且可以给人类带来更大质的帮助

人工智能下围棋主要应用了哪种算法技术?

目前世界上流行的围棋软件主要由三种算法组成。

1 使每个棋子周围产生某种影响,这种影响随着距离的增加而减少,用一定的公式计算叠加这种影响,以判断和估计着点的价值

2 建立模式库,贮存大量模式(定式棋形等),以供匹配,这其实涉及围棋中的许多棋谚和棋理,如二子头必扳,断从一边长,盘角曲四等。

3 对目标明确的局部,用人工智能中的探索法求其结果。

什么是人工智能算法?

你们说的都太复杂了,希望我的描述能让外行们看懂。

当前运用的人工智能的算法,在本质上就是输入x得到反馈y。

至于怎么从x得到的y,我们可以列一个线性方程y = mx + b。

它表示是x和y的关系。只不过是从前我们学的是根据x求y,在人工智能领域是,知道输入x和输出y,要求出的是系数m和常数b。

线性回归

有监督学习就是持续输入大量的配对的x和y,调整系数m和常数b,让线性方程更好的匹配数据。这个方程永远不能以百分之百的准确率匹配x和y,但是它能被用来做预测。一旦你确定了一个可靠的函数,你输入x的值,变成得到一个正确率很高的y值。

即使复杂如阿尔法狗,它不过是得到了一个无比复杂的系数m,万变不离其宗,它的算法仍然能被表达为y = mx + b

聚类分析

有监督学习还可以被用来做分类,类似于把水从池子里分到桶里。例如,如果数据带有特点x,它进入一号桶;如果没有,它进入二号桶。在这种情况下,你仍然可能认为这是在用x预测y,只是在这里y不是数值而是类别。当然,分水的桶可以准备很多。

分类算法可以来过滤垃圾邮件,分析x光片的异常,确认案件的相关资料,为一个岗位选择合适的简历,甚至做market segmentation。

到此,以上就是小编对于人工智能技术主要算法的问题就介绍到这了,希望介绍关于人工智能技术主要算法的6点解答对大家有用。

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.bfgfmw.com/post/9252.html

算法人工智能神经网络
人工智能技术有学习-人工智能技术学的是什么 楚天龙新增人工智能概念-楚天龙新增人工智能概念9.15